Transaction dd680d177ec219105c66e4ef3f6d644b1bbf20a5abcd71b3ee7e08085248cb26
1 Input
1 Output
-
dd680d177ec219105c66e4ef3f6d644b1bbf20a5abcd71b3ee7e08085248cb26:0
- value
- 329617
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6327039487e77a75ed0c06a2bafc3730a9b8fdb7 OP_EQUAL
- address
- 3AjHZGrai275NoVGe6o76Nxt7SkPUovYQT